Greyhawk-to-Homebrew: How I blended the Velaeri with D&D Basic Immortals ideas to create Avatars of the Seasons
Quick update on the Hawklands Campaign Primer - An Alternate Greyhawk Campaign Setting - I finally completed the Wind Giant series (The Wind Giants - An Overview - Demi-God Avatars)- taking the old Greyhawk Oeridian agricultural gods of the seasons/weather/wind (the Velaeri) & mixing them with a more demi-god avatar approach (harkening back to elements from the basic D&D Immortal set).
The result - the Seasonal Winds & Weather themselves are divine, they change their shape every few centuries (or sometimes only decades) with new avatars & characters at high levels can "ascend" to be the next Seasonal avatar.
This get's some fun pairing of "old school content" - where I was able to take the historical Greyhawk NPC & artifacts lore (Archmage Philidor & the swanmay Sharnalem, Black Razor for the Telchur avatar, etc.) & recast in the "avatar ascending to demi-god" model. In the end, a great way to "retire" high-level PCs in a NPC impact arc (so you wanna be a god? Just defeat the current Wind Giant avatar...).
